Patrick Nebeling
Patrick Nebeling

Patrick Nebeling · Career

Career

View on LinkedIn

Boardwalk REIT · Calgary, AB

22 years, 9 months

At Boardwalk Real Estate Investment Trust since 2003 — from Software Developer to Director of Software Engineering.


  1. Nov 2020 — Present · 5y 6mo

    Director of Software Engineering

    • Lead software development and QA; drive technical vision, enterprise architecture, and delivery aligned with business goals.
    • Architect resilient systems: microservices, APIs, cloud platforms, and integrations across Product, Infrastructure, and Security.
    • Champion Agile, CI/CD, and engineering excellence; shape SDLC quality, security, and delivery cadence.
    • Define QA strategy and metrics for reliable, high-performing releases; uphold standards that reduce defects and downtime.
    • Own hiring, development, and retention for engineering and QA; budgets, tooling consistency, and cross-team collaboration.
    • Hands-on delivery: scalable modular services and APIs (.NET, Azure); BPMS modernization from monolithic WebForms toward modular APIs and React.
    StrategyArchitectureAzure.NETMicroservicesAgileCI/CDReactTypeScriptSQL
  2. Jun 2018 — Oct 2020 · 2y 5mo

    Technical Lead

    • Directed development and QA in an Agile setting—hands-on through complex technical challenges while keeping the team aligned.
    • Partnered with business to analyze, design, and deliver systems that improved processes and productivity.
    • Set technical direction for build, maintenance, and testing; aligned work with enterprise IT architecture.
    • Led manual and automated QA: estimation, planning, and strategy for test coverage and release confidence.
    • Facilitated code reviews, technical design sessions, and cross-functional communication; mentored engineering and Agile practices.
    • Supported team health through recruiting, selection, and training.
    .NETAgileCI/CDAutomationTDDQALeadership
  3. Jun 2014 — May 2018 · 3y 11mo

    Lead Developer

    • Maintained and evolved in-house applications; collaborated with business teams to design and deliver new systems.
    • Created and enforced coding standards and policies; documented new and existing functionality.
    • Provided leadership and mentoring—oversaw developers on projects, coached the team, and modeled continuous learning.
    VB.NETASP.NETSQL ServerWinFormsReportingLeadership
  4. Apr 2007 — May 2014 · 7y 1mo

    Senior Developer

    • Maintained in-house software; partnered with business to design and develop new systems.
    • Established coding standards and policies and ensured adoption through examples and monitoring.
    • Led, coached, and trained team members; produced documentation for new and existing functionality.
    • Expert troubleshooting in distributed environments; applied enterprise architecture practices for scalable solutions.
    VB.NETASP.NETSQL ServerWinFormsWebArchitectureMentoring
  5. Oct 2006 — Mar 2007 · 5mo

    Intermediate Developer

    • Maintained in-house applications; owned complex assignments with business and senior IT to deliver new features and applications.
    • Documented new and existing functionality and upheld organizational coding standards.
    • Solid troubleshooting across distributed systems.
    VB.NETASP.NETT-SQLWinFormsWeb FormsReporting
  6. Aug 2003 — Sep 2006 · 3y 1mo

    Software Developer

    • Maintained in-house applications; contributed to new capabilities alongside business teams and senior IT.
    • Documented existing functionality and followed documented coding standards and policies.
    VB.NETASP.NETHTML/CSS/JSMSSQLWinFormsWeb Forms